
在Excel中使用括号可以帮助你控制计算的顺序、确保公式的逻辑性、避免错误。 首先,我们需要理解括号的基本功能:括号用于在公式中明确指定计算的顺序,Excel会首先计算括号内的表达式,然后再进行其他计算。这在复杂公式中尤为重要,因为它可以确保计算按照预期进行。接下来,我们将详细介绍如何在Excel公式中使用括号,并提供一些实际应用的示例。
一、基本概念和重要性
在Excel中,运算符的优先级决定了计算顺序。默认情况下,Excel按照以下顺序进行计算:括号、指数、乘除、加减。如果没有括号,Excel会先进行乘除运算,再进行加减运算。因此,使用括号可以改变默认的计算顺序,确保公式按照你的预期进行计算。
示例:
假设你有一个公式 =5 + 2 * 3。按照默认的运算符优先级,Excel会先计算乘法,然后再进行加法,结果是 11。但是,如果你希望先进行加法,再进行乘法,你需要使用括号,修改公式为 =(5 + 2) * 3,这样结果就是 21。
二、括号在不同类型公式中的应用
1、简单算术运算
在简单的算术运算中,括号可以帮助你确保计算顺序。例如,计算某个值的百分比并加上一个固定值时,你可以使用括号来明确计算顺序。
示例:
=(A1 * 0.1) + B1
在这个公式中,括号确保了先计算 A1 的 10%,然后再加上 B1 的值。
2、嵌套括号
在更复杂的公式中,你可能需要使用嵌套括号。嵌套括号是指在一个括号内再包含另一个括号,这可以帮助你在多个层次上控制计算顺序。
示例:
=((A1 + B1) * (C1 - D1)) / (E1 + F1)
在这个公式中,Excel首先计算最内层的括号 (A1 + B1) 和 (C1 - D1),然后再计算外层的括号,将结果相乘,最后除以 (E1 + F1) 的结果。
三、实际应用场景
1、财务计算
在财务计算中,括号可以帮助你准确计算复利、折旧和其他复杂的财务公式。例如,计算复利时,你可能需要使用括号来确保公式的正确性。
示例:
=P * (1 + r/n)^(n*t)
在这个公式中,P 是本金,r 是年利率,n 是每年的复利次数,t 是时间(以年为单位)。括号确保了先计算 (1 + r/n),然后再进行指数运算。
2、统计分析
在统计分析中,括号可以帮助你准确计算平均值、标准差和其他统计指标。例如,计算加权平均时,你可能需要使用括号来确保公式的正确性。
示例:
=(SUMPRODUCT(A1:A10, B1:B10)) / SUM(B1:B10)
在这个公式中,括号确保了先计算 SUMPRODUCT(A1:A10, B1:B10),然后再除以 SUM(B1:B10) 的结果。
四、错误排查与优化
使用括号时,可能会遇到一些常见错误,例如括号不匹配或使用错误的括号类型(如全角括号)。为了避免这些错误,可以遵循以下几点建议:
- 检查括号匹配:确保每个打开的括号都有一个对应的关闭括号。
- 使用公式审核工具:Excel提供了公式审核工具,可以帮助你检查公式中的括号匹配情况。
- 简化公式:如果公式过于复杂,可以考虑将其拆分为多个简单的公式,逐步验证每个部分的正确性。
五、括号与函数的结合
在Excel中,括号不仅用于算术运算,还用于函数调用。每个函数的参数都需要放在括号内,并且可以使用嵌套括号来调用多个函数。
1、单一函数
调用单一函数时,括号用于包含函数的参数。
示例:
=SUM(A1:A10)
在这个公式中,括号包含了函数 SUM 的参数 A1:A10。
2、嵌套函数
在嵌套函数中,括号可以帮助你明确函数的调用顺序。例如,计算某个范围内的最大值并加上一个固定值时,你可以使用嵌套函数。
示例:
=MAX(A1:A10) + 10
在这个公式中,括号确保了先调用 MAX(A1:A10) 函数,然后再加上 10。
六、进阶技巧
1、动态引用
使用括号时,可以结合动态引用来创建更灵活的公式。例如,使用 INDIRECT 函数动态引用单元格。
示例:
=SUM(INDIRECT("A" & B1 & ":A" & B2))
在这个公式中,括号确保了 INDIRECT 函数的参数是正确的引用范围。
2、数组公式
在数组公式中,括号可以帮助你明确数组的范围和操作。例如,使用 MMULT 函数进行矩阵乘法。
示例:
=MMULT(A1:B2, C1:D2)
在这个公式中,括号包含了两个矩阵的范围,确保 MMULT 函数能够正确计算。
七、总结
通过以上内容,我们深入探讨了在Excel公式中使用括号的重要性和应用场景。从基本的算术运算到复杂的财务计算和统计分析,再到函数和数组公式,括号在确保计算顺序和逻辑性方面发挥了关键作用。使用括号可以帮助你避免错误、提高公式的准确性和可读性。在实际应用中,掌握括号的使用技巧,可以让你在处理复杂数据时更加得心应手。
相关问答FAQs:
1. 如何在Excel中使用括号来改变计算顺序?
在Excel中,使用括号可以改变计算公式的执行顺序。当公式中存在多个运算符时,括号可以明确指定先进行哪些运算。例如,如果你想先进行乘法运算,然后再进行加法运算,可以使用括号将乘法部分括起来。
2. 如何在Excel中使用括号来创建复杂的计算公式?
使用括号可以帮助你创建复杂的计算公式。例如,如果你需要在公式中进行多个嵌套的计算,可以使用括号来明确指定每个嵌套计算的顺序。这样可以确保公式的正确性和准确性。
3. 如何在Excel中使用括号来提高计算公式的可读性?
使用括号可以使计算公式更易读和易理解。通过使用括号,你可以将公式中的不同部分分组,并清晰地表示出运算的顺序。这样,其他人阅读你的公式时将更容易理解其中的逻辑和意图。括号可以使公式更具可读性和可维护性。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4814053